An organization uses Terraform to manage multi-cloud infrastructure across AWS and Azure. The state file must be stored securely with locking to prevent concurrent modifications. Which backend configuration should the team use?

Correct answer & explanation

AWS S3 bucket with DynamoDB table for locking

Terraform supports remote backends like AWS S3 with DynamoDB for state locking, which provides both state storage and locking. Azure Blob Storage can also be used with blob lease locking.

Option-by-option breakdown

For each option: why learners choose it and why it is or isn't the right answer here.

  • GitHub repository with Terraform Cloud agent

    Why it's wrong here

    GitHub is not a Terraform backend; Terraform Cloud is a separate service.

  • Azure DevOps pipeline variable group

    Why it's wrong here

    Variable groups store environment variables, not Terraform state.

  • AWS S3 bucket with DynamoDB table for locking

    Why this is correct

    S3 stores state; DynamoDB provides state locking, preventing concurrent operations.

  • Local file system with .terraform.lock.hcl

    Why it's wrong here

    Local state does not support remote locking and is not suitable for team use.

AWS S3 Storage Class Comparison

Storage ClassMin DurationRetrievalUse Case
S3 StandardNoneImmediateFrequently accessed data
S3 Standard-IA30 daysImmediateInfrequent access, rapid retrieval
S3 One Zone-IA30 daysImmediateNon-critical infrequent data
S3 Intelligent-TieringNoneImmediate–hoursUnknown or changing access patterns
S3 Glacier Instant90 daysMillisecondsArchive with instant retrieval
S3 Glacier Flexible90 daysMinutes–hoursArchive, flexible retrieval
S3 Glacier Deep Archive180 daysHoursLong-term compliance archive
